We’ll start where Euro 2012 starts: in the Eastern European nation of Poland.

Poland is one of the co-hosts of this summer’s European Championships. Although the host is unlikely to lift the coveted Henri Delaunay Cup, it can certainly consider itself winners off the field. Although home fans will expect their team to make it out of Group A, they’ll consider any further progress to a be a summer bonus.

Fans from across Europe and the rest of the world will enjoy the hospitality that the Polish people will extend their way. The hosts will be out en masse wearing red and white. It is up to them to make sure the party is a good one.
